Namajunas and Andrade agree to rematch at UFC event on July 11

Former UFC strawweight champions Rose Namajunas and Jessica Andrade are running it back on July 11.

According to Brett Okamoto of ESPN, Namajunas and Andrade agreed to the rematch. The bout is expected to be on the UFC 251 card. There is no official location for the bout.

In May, UFC president Dana White said he would live on “Fight Island” throughout July. White added the UFC would hold three to four events on the island during July. 

The bout was originally scheduled for UFC 249, but was scratched when Rose withdrew.

It is a little over a year since Andrade took the strap from Namajunas with a slam knockout in the second round at UFC 237 in May 2019. It is the last time Namajunas stepped into the octagon.

Previously, the 27-year-old won and defended the strap, defeating Joanna Jedrzejczyk on two occasions. Namajunas handed Jedrzejczyk her first career loss via first-round TKO at UFC 217 in November 2017. 

She then earned a unanimous decision against Jedrzejczyk at UFC 223 in April 2018.

“Thug Rose” was riding a three-fight unbeaten streak when she lost to Andrade.

After winning the title from Namajunas, Andrade dropped the belt in a first-round TKO loss to Weili Zhang at UFC on ESPN+ 15 in August 2019. The defeat ended a four-fight win streak for the Brazilian.
